LOS ANGELES, Sept. 20, 2018 /PRNewswire-PRWeb/ -- Dr. Matt Nejad, a lead dentist at an upscale dental practice in Beverly Hills, is best known for his elite training and sought-after expertise in biomimetic dentistry and cosmetic dentistry. Biomimetic dentistry is a unique dental specialty that employs minimally-invasive techniques and a natural approach in restorative dentistry which aims to mimic the natural tooth in strength, function, esthetics, and biology/health. The correct application of materials and technique allows dentists to preserve more natural tooth structures and deliver more sustainable, longer-term results.
Advertisement

As both a practicing biomimetic dentist as well as an educator in the field, Dr. Nejad was invited to speak at the 11th USC International Restorative Dentistry Symposium on October 13, 2018 in Los Angeles. Dr. Nejad will discuss the topic of Poster Onlay and Inlay restorations, a dental treatment growing in popularity due to concerns over removing additional tooth structure for crowns and the ensuing complications. Applying the bioimimetic approach, teeth can be restored with conservative measures that often result in significantly less loss of natural, healthy tooth structures. This not only gives the best ultimate strength and long-term success, but also minimizes the occurrence of root canals and other invasive treatments.
